A commentary published on the source of political cartoons on Sunday reflected on the national unity that emerged during the search for four-year-old Yuval Kogan, who was found safe on Friday after a massive search operation. The author, cartoonist Yildos Gomez, argued that the episode carries a political lesson for the right-wing bloc. 'This unity proves that our nation has learned the lesson and will not tolerate another partnership with Arab parties to form a government that is subordinate to and serves our enemies,' the commentary stated, alluding to the previous government.
